Output 59a1ba7d6d09ffc6c723cc6654c5bd2ea143a2693c9fe131087436a44c6dfb30:12
- value
- 39569866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fe6a083498be64b70d72507204e2ae7eed942d9 OP_EQUAL
- address
- MRPqaKDcSDuqFaiQaJsaA6ENryjnEeoHHs
- transaction
- 59a1ba7d6d09ffc6c723cc6654c5bd2ea143a2693c9fe131087436a44c6dfb30
- spent
- true